Installing MailWizz: Requirements and Best Practices
To successfully set up MailWizz, several key requirements must be met . Primarily, you’ll demand a stable server platform running PHP 7.4 or newer , along with a database version 5.7 or above . It’s greatly suggested to confirm that your server meets the minimum system resources , which usually require at least 512MB of RAM. Furthermore , you should consider using a dedicated domain or subdomain for your MailWizz instance to minimize potential conflicts with other applications. Following these optimal practices will substantially enhance the reliability and overall success of your email marketing platform .

MailWizz Installation: From Download to First Email
Getting MailWizz up and running is surprisingly straightforward, even for those without extensive technical expertise. The process begins with acquiring the latest version from the official website. Afterward, you'll unpack the files to a appropriate location on your server, typically using an FTP client like FileZilla or a similar tool. Subsequently, you’ll navigate to the installation directory in your web browser – usually something like `yourdomain.com/mailwizz/install/` – and initiate the installation guide. You'll be prompted to provide essential database details, such as the database name, username, and password. It's crucial to create a fresh, empty database beforehand. After submitting the database configuration, you'll set your admin credentials and confirm the license. Finally, click the install button to finish the setup. You’ll then be permitted to enter your MailWizz admin panel and send your very first sample email – a sure sign that everything is working smoothly.
